Fullständig meny med priser & bilder
Subway 317 W State St, Geneva, IL 60134, Un...
+16302322964
Boka ett bord nu för Subway
Kommer du med bil till Subway i Geneva, så hittar du parkeringsmöjligheter på 712 meter på Metra Geneva-Parking Lot B, eller du kan ta offentlig transport och hoppa av vid hållplatsen Metra-Geneva Station, som ligger 734 meter från Subway.